How Much Does Land Clearing Cost? (2024 Estimates)

Figuring out the expense of property clearing in 2024 can be challenging, as quite a few factors influence the total figure. Generally, you can anticipate to pay anywhere from $1,000 to $10,000, but this’s really a broad range. The size of the plot is a major element, with greater areas obviously costing more. Also, the abundance of vegetation – including trees, shrubs, and stumps – dramatically dictates the price. Clearing Land with a Skid Steer Advice & Secure Measures

Utilizing a skid steer for land clearing can significantly accelerate the process, but protection is paramount. Always you comprehend the machine's capabilities and limitations. Thoroughly inspect the location for hidden cables before you start any operations. Regularly verify the attachment for damage and confirm a solid base before moving loads. Use appropriate safety gear, including safety glasses, hearing protection, and hand coverings. Remember to keep a safe distance from bystanders and watch out for overhead obstructions. Adequate training is vital for drivers to minimize incidents.
